Online Mental Health Assessments
Online mental health assessments are a convenient and simple method for people to test for signs of anxiety and depression. These assessments are typically built on diagnostic assessment mental health tools that have been clinically validated. They also offer informational resources and assist to find the best treatment options.
However some online tests aren't reliable and may stigmatize mental health issues. It is essential to choose quality tools that prioritize privacy and data security.

There are many different types of online assessments for mental health. Some are founded on validated diagnostic tools clinically proven to be effective such as the Patient Health Questionnaire-9 (PHQ-9). Others are designed to detect specific disorders, like depression and nearby anxiety. Others are more general, asking questions about feelings and behavior. Whatever their purpose, all online assessments should be used in conjunction to professional treatment.

They have been validated clinically.
Online mental health tests have become a common method of screening for mental illnesses or disorders. These tests use questionnaires to assess the person's depression, anxiety mood, mood, and other disorders. These tests are based on tools that have been verified by mental health professionals and can provide valuable data to the patient's psychiatrist or therapy.
The efficacy of online mental health assessment tools has been analyzed by researchers, who have compared them with other screening methods. Several studies have found that self-report online questionnaires can effectively supplement in-person clinical evaluations in people suffering from psychiatric disorders. They can also help clinicians keep track of the development of a patient between appointments.
However, it is crucial to keep in mind that online mental health assessments are only a snapshot of the person's health issues at a specific point in time. Despite the widespread availability of these tools, a physician should always perform an in-person assessment to confirm the diagnosis and give detailed advice about treatment.
Many online tests use question set built on clinically validated diagnostic tools like the Patient's Health Questionnaire-9. These questions were tested by doctors to help identify individuals who suffer from certain conditions like depression and anxiety. Other tests that turn symptoms into personality traits or labels aren't clinically valid and may stigmatize the conditions they claim to diagnose.
